The Anatomy and Essence of Manipura
The solar plexus chakra, or Manipura, is strategically positioned within the physical body to govern the transition from the physical survival instincts of the lower chakras to the emotional intelligence of the heart. It is located in the middle of the body, specifically situated about two to six inches above the belly button, residing within the diaphragm. This location is critical as it connects the respiratory system—our lifeline of breath—with the digestive system, where we process not only food but experiences.
The elemental association of the solar plexus is fire, known in certain traditions as Agni. This fire element is the primary catalyst for transformation; it is the energy that burns away the dross of negativity to manifest and sustain the positive. Without this internal fire, the human spirit becomes lethargic and stagnant. The color associated with this center is yellow, a hue that evokes the sun, intellect, and optimism.
The primary responsibilities of the solar plexus chakra include:
- Regulation of action and intention: It transforms thoughts into tangible results.
- Establishment of identity: It defines who a person is independent of others.
- Maintenance of vitality: It provides the raw energy needed to execute daily tasks.
- Governance of willpower: It fuels the determination required to overcome obstacles.
- Management of self-esteem: It dictates the internal value one assigns to themselves.

The Cobra Posture (Bhujangasana)
The Cobra Pose is an essential tool for balancing the functions of the internal organs associated with the solar plexus, including the stomach, gallbladder, liver, spleen, and pancreas. It creates a gentle bow shape with the spine, increasing the flexibility and strength of the lower back.
Execution Steps:
- Start by lying face down with your legs and feet close together.
- Rest your forehead on the ground.
- Place your palms on the floor next to your chest.
- Keep your elbows close to your body and pointing upward.
- Inhale deeply while pressing your belly button into the floor.
- Lift your head and chest off the ground.
- Squeeze your buttocks and roll your shoulders away from your ears.
- Press your pelvis firmly into the floor.
- Hold the pose and breathe naturally.
- After a breath, bring your chest back to the ground.
- Repeat the sequence until the chakra feels open and activated.
